1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Order the following numbers from least to greatest: 3π, √10, 3.25

Back

√10, 3.25, 3π

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which of the following is rational? .211232112421125..., π, √25, √12

Back

√25

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

The √40 is between which two integers?

Back

6 & 7

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which of the following numbers is rational? √8, √16, √50, √75

Back

√16

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

A non-ending, non-repeating decimal is which type of number?

Back

Irrational

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define a rational number.

Back

A number that can be expressed as a fraction a/b, where a and b are integers and b ≠ 0.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define an irrational number.

Back

A number that cannot be expressed as a simple fraction; its decimal representation is non-ending and non-repeating.
